A commemorative postage stamp issuing on the occasion of Africa Day Address by H.E Abdelhamid Chebchoub, Ambassador of Algeria Dean of the Group of African Ambassadors

Dear Mr. Djordjevic, Director of the Post of Serbia and Dear friend, Excellencies the Ambassadors and diplomatic representatives, Dear friends.

On behalf of the Group of African Ambassadors in Belgrade I would like to thank Mr. Zoran Djordjevic and the Post of Serbia for this initiative on the very day of Africa Day and Friendship Day between Africa and Serbia celebration.

This initiative is not a surprise to us knowing Mr. Djordjevic’s bonds of friendship with all African ambassadors and the will he has always demonstrated to promote cooperation between Serbia and the African Countries.

The decision of the Post of Serbia to issue a postage stamp on the theme of Africa Day is a strong symbol of this friendship which will remain throughout the annals of the postage stamp, as its witness.

The postage stamp does not represent only a postal value, nor is solely a collector’s item for philatelists, but it is above all, a memory that conveys throughout centuries the history of humanity, its dramas and successes, its flora and fauna, its technological progress and creative spirit.

This stamp which is issued today is a new piece of evidence which attests to the existence of friendship ties between Africa and Serbia and will help undoubtedly, dear friends, to immortalize this special relationship between our continent and your country.

Also, before concluding I would like to suggest being convinced that my colleagues from the African group of Ambassadors will support the idea, so that we can organize together, right here, an exhibition of the African stamp throughout history.

Thank you for your attention.
